Our understanding of Lyme and other tick-borne illnesses has changed dramatically since 2014, and much of what we thought we knew about the subject has been turned on its head since then. Don’t stick your head in the sand -- come learn what the threats are and how to manage them. (And how to get sand out of one’s ears.)

Paul Hetzler is the Horticulture and Natural Resources Educator for Cornell Cooperative Extension of St. Lawrence County.
